Behavioral Consequences of Drinking: An Investigation of Factorial Invariance across Gender
Derby, Dustin C.; Smith, Thomas J.
Measurement and Evaluation in Counseling and Development, v47 n1 p52-61 Jan 2014
The purpose of the current study was to assess the gender invariance of an a priori four-factor solution of behavioral consequences of drinking. Results evidenced strong partial measurement invariance, with marginal structural invariance, which signals that the underlying constructs possessed the same theoretical structure for both men and women.
